引言
随着人工智能技术的飞速发展,大模型(Large Language Models,LLMs)在自然语言处理领域取得了显著的成果。微调(Fine-tuning)作为大模型应用中的一个重要环节,能够使模型更好地适应特定任务。而提示词(Prompt)在微调过程中扮演着至关重要的角色,它能够引导模型生成符合预期结果的文本。本文将深入探讨大模型微调中的提示词工程,解析其原理、技巧和应用。
一、大模型微调概述
1.1 大模型简介
大模型是指具有海量参数和强大语言理解能力的神经网络模型。常见的有GPT、BERT、T5等。这些模型在训练过程中积累了丰富的语言知识,能够处理各种自然语言任务。
1.2 微调概念
微调是在预训练模型的基础上,针对特定任务进行优化调整的过程。通过微调,模型能够更好地适应特定领域和任务,提高任务性能。
二、提示词工程
2.1 提示词定义
提示词是用户输入给大模型的一段指令,用于引导模型生成符合预期结果的文本。提示词可以是问题、图片、语音或文本等形式。
2.2 提示词工程目标
提示词工程的目标是设计出能够引导模型生成高质量文本的提示词。具体目标包括:
- 明确任务目标:使模型理解任务需求,如生成文章、翻译文本或回答问题。
- 提供背景信息:为模型提供必要的上下文信息,帮助其理解任务背景。
- 设定输出格式:指明输出文本的格式,如段落、列表或表格。
2.3 提示词设计技巧
- 明确任务目标:设计清晰的提示词,使模型明白任务目标。
- 提供背景信息:为模型提供必要的上下文信息,帮助其理解任务背景。
- 设定输出格式:指明输出的格式,如要求生成段落、列表或表格。
- 优化前后示例:通过对比优化前后的提示词,不断调整以达到最优效果。
三、提示词在微调中的应用
3.1 提示词引导模型生成高质量文本
通过设计合适的提示词,可以引导模型生成符合预期结果的文本。例如,在生成文章时,提示词可以包含文章主题、结构、风格等信息。
3.2 提示词优化模型性能
在微调过程中,通过不断优化提示词,可以提高模型在特定任务上的性能。例如,在问答系统中,优化提示词可以提升模型对问题的理解和回答能力。
3.3 提示词促进模型泛化能力
通过设计具有代表性的提示词,可以促进模型在未知任务上的泛化能力。例如,在多模态任务中,设计包含不同模态信息的提示词,可以提高模型在不同模态上的表现。
四、总结
提示词工程在大模型微调过程中发挥着至关重要的作用。通过设计合适的提示词,可以引导模型生成高质量文本,优化模型性能,并促进模型泛化能力。在未来的研究中,提示词工程将继续为人工智能领域的发展贡献力量。